Took our Clarity in today to have SB 18-090 installed. I asked the service manager if he would mind performing the battery capacity test (since I didn't get the PDI with my car a year ago). He said "sure !" It literally only took 5 minutes to print the results. He offered to do it again after the SB work and charging the car to 100% (they actually had a 30A L2 charger) just for the heck of it, to see what differences there were. Attached are pics of the 6 page reports (left side pre SB, right side post SB). Took the dealer about 1 hour to do the SB. The battery capacity came in at 54.1Ah. Since I garage (unheated) my car 3 months out of the year in the Michigan winter the manager suggested I bring the car in for the complementary tests before I garage it and then again in the spring to see how the inactivity affects the test items.
